在使用RuoYi框架時,選擇合適的PostgreSQL版本是非常重要的。以下是一些關于RuoYi框架和PostgreSQL版本選擇的信息:
RuoYi框架對PostgreSQL版本的支持
RuoYi框架支持多種數據庫,包括MySQL、PostgreSQL等。對于PostgreSQL,RuoYi提供了相應的數據庫驅動和配置文件支持,使得在RuoYi項目中使用PostgreSQL作為數據庫成為可能。
PostgreSQL版本策略
- 主要版本:PostgreSQL全球開發組計劃每年發布一個包含新功能的主要版本。當前最新的主要版本是PostgreSQL 16,下一個主要版本是PostgreSQL 17,預計2024年9月發布。
- 次要版本:對于每個主要版本,至少每3個月會發布一個次要版本,用于修復問題和安全漏洞。當前最新的次要版本是PostgreSQL 16.4。
RuoYi框架的數據庫配置
- 數據庫連接配置:在RuoYi框架中,數據庫的連接配置通常位于
application.yml
文件中。你需要配置數據庫的URL、用戶名、密碼等信息。
- 多數據源配置:RuoYi框架支持多數據源配置,允許你在同一個項目中使用多個數據庫實例,如主庫和從庫。
注意事項
- 版本兼容性:確保你選擇的PostgreSQL版本與RuoYi框架兼容。建議使用RuoYi框架官方文檔中推薦的版本。
- 性能優化:使用最新的次要版本可以獲得更好的性能和安全更新。
綜上所述,對于RuoYi框架的PostgreSQL版本選擇,建議使用最新的主要版本PostgreSQL 16,并關注其最新的次要版本更新,以確保最佳的性能和安全。同時,確保你的RuoYi框架版本與所選PostgreSQL版本兼容,并考慮使用最新的次要版本以獲得最佳性能。